Does God Still Speak Through Prophets?

In this episode, Bryan, Bo and KD talk about how the Mormon church claims to have prophets who speak authoritatively for God. But is that really a thing anymore? If not, how do we hear from God? This podcast explores the answer to that question. They discuss the role of the Holy Spirit in the Old and New Testaments, the concept of worthiness in Mormonism, and the differences between capital P prophets and lowercase p prophets. They emphasize that every believer now has the Holy Spirit and that the Bible is God's authoritative Word. They also talk about the closed canon and the importance of testing everything against God's Word.

Takeaways:

  • There are two different types of prophets: a capital “P” prophet who speaks authoritatively for God, and a lowercase “p” prophet who speaks what God has already spoken.
  • The canon of Scripture is closed, meaning that God is not going to speak authoritatively through prophets anymore.
  • The Bible is God's authoritative word and does not need to be supplemented with new revelation from prophets.
  • The gift of prophecy in the local church is about reminding people of what God has already spoken, not bringing new revelation.
  • Believers should test everything against God's Word and hold on to what is good.
